It took years of negotiations and many anxious members waiting, but Driftpile Cree Nation and Sucker Creek Cree Nation began receiving last week or will soon receive their 'cows and plows' cheques. The Ermineskin Cree Nation (Reserve #138) is one member of the Four Nations of Maskwacis, Alberta located in Central Alberta about fifty miles south of Edmonton on Highway 2A, halfway between the towns of Ponoka and Wetaskiwin. Cows and plows is the nickname for promises made by the signers of Treaty 8, to provide First Nations members the means to take up farming. The Driftpile First Nation (or the Driftpile Cree Nation) ( Cree: , mihtatakaw spy) is a Treaty 8 [2] First Nation with a reserve, Drift Pile River 150, located on the southern shore of the Lesser Slave Lake on Alberta Highway 2 in Northern Alberta.
